博客 国产自研数据底座:分布式计算与高可用性架构解析

国产自研数据底座:分布式计算与高可用性架构解析

   数栈君   发表于 2025-10-18 10:41  77  0

国产自研数据底座:分布式计算与高可用性架构解析

在数字化转型的浪潮中,数据作为核心生产要素,其价值日益凸显。而数据底座作为支撑企业数据管理和应用的基础平台,扮演着至关重要的角色。近年来,随着技术的进步和国产化需求的增加,国产自研数据底座逐渐成为企业关注的焦点。本文将深入解析国产自研数据底座的核心技术——分布式计算与高可用性架构,为企业在选择和构建数据底座时提供参考。

什么是数据底座?

数据底座(Data Foundation)是企业级的数据管理与分析平台,旨在为企业提供统一的数据存储、处理、分析和可视化能力。它通过整合企业内外部数据,构建数据资产目录,实现数据的全生命周期管理。数据底座的核心目标是为企业提供高效、可靠、安全的数据服务,支持数据驱动的决策和业务创新。

对于数据中台、数字孪生和数字可视化等领域的企业和个人而言,数据底座是实现数据价值的重要基石。它不仅能够提升数据处理效率,还能降低数据管理的成本,为企业创造更大的价值。


分布式计算:数据底座的核心技术

分布式计算是数据底座实现高效数据处理的关键技术之一。在现代企业中,数据规模往往以PB级甚至更大计算,单台服务器难以满足处理需求。因此,分布式计算通过将数据和计算任务分发到多台节点上,实现并行处理,从而提升计算效率。

分布式计算的实现原理

分布式计算的核心在于任务的分解与协同。具体来说,数据底座会将大规模数据集拆分成多个小块,分别存储在不同的节点上。同时,计算任务也被分解为多个子任务,分别在各个节点上执行。通过这种方式,数据底座能够充分利用多台节点的计算资源,显著提升处理速度。

此外,分布式计算还依赖于高效的通信机制。节点之间需要实时交换数据和计算结果,以确保任务的顺利进行。为此,数据底座通常采用分布式通信框架(如Kafka、RabbitMQ等),确保数据传输的高效性和可靠性。

分布式计算的优势

  1. 高扩展性:分布式计算能够根据数据规模和计算需求动态扩展节点数量,满足企业的弹性计算需求。
  2. 高吞吐量:通过并行处理,分布式计算能够显著提升数据处理的吞吐量,支持实时数据分析。
  3. 故障容错:分布式计算通过任务的冗余和节点的负载均衡,能够在部分节点故障时仍保证任务的完成。

对于数据中台而言,分布式计算能够支持复杂的ETL(数据抽取、转换、加载)任务和实时数据处理,为企业提供高效的数据处理能力。而在数字孪生和数字可视化领域,分布式计算能够支持大规模数据的实时渲染和分析,为企业提供更丰富的数据应用场景。


高可用性架构:确保数据底座的稳定性

高可用性是数据底座的另一个核心特性。数据底座作为企业级平台,必须具备极高的稳定性和可靠性,以确保数据服务的持续可用。高可用性架构通过冗余设计、故障隔离和快速恢复等手段,最大限度地降低系统故障对业务的影响。

高可用性架构的设计原则

  1. 冗余设计:通过部署多台节点,确保在单点故障发生时,系统仍能正常运行。例如,数据底座可以通过主从复制、多活集群等方式实现数据的冗余存储。
  2. 负载均衡:通过负载均衡技术,将请求均匀分配到多个节点上,避免单点过载。这不仅提升了系统的处理能力,还降低了单点故障的风险。
  3. 故障隔离:当某个节点发生故障时,系统能够快速将其隔离,并将流量转移到其他正常节点上。这种方式可以有效防止故障扩散,保障系统的整体稳定性。
  4. 快速恢复:通过自动化恢复机制,系统能够在故障发生后快速恢复服务。例如,数据底座可以通过自动重启、自动扩缩容等手段,实现快速恢复。

高可用性架构的关键技术

  1. 分布式数据库:分布式数据库是高可用性架构的重要组成部分。它通过将数据分片存储在多个节点上,实现数据的高可用性和高扩展性。常见的分布式数据库包括MySQL Group Replication、TiDB等。
  2. 容器化与 orchestration:通过容器化技术(如Docker)和 orchestration平台(如Kubernetes),数据底座可以实现服务的自动部署、自动扩缩容和自动恢复。这种方式不仅提升了系统的可用性,还简化了运维管理。
  3. 监控与告警:通过实时监控系统运行状态,数据底座可以及时发现潜在故障,并通过告警机制通知运维人员。这种方式能够显著提升系统的故障响应速度,降低故障对业务的影响。

对于数字孪生和数字可视化而言,高可用性架构能够确保数据的实时性和稳定性,为企业提供更可靠的可视化体验。而在数据中台领域,高可用性架构能够保障数据处理任务的稳定运行,为企业提供更高效的数据服务。


为什么选择国产自研数据底座?

随着全球数字化转型的深入推进,数据安全和自主可控成为企业关注的焦点。国产自研数据底座通过采用自主研发的技术和架构,能够有效降低企业对国外技术的依赖,提升企业的核心竞争力。

国产自研数据底座的优势

  1. 自主可控:国产自研数据底座完全基于自主研发的技术,能够避免因技术封锁或供应链中断而导致的业务风险。
  2. 性能优化:针对国内企业的实际需求,国产数据底座能够进行针对性优化,提供更高效的数据处理能力。
  3. 成本优势:相比进口产品,国产数据底座通常具有更低的采购和维护成本,能够帮助企业节省预算。

国产自研数据底座的典型应用场景

  1. 数据中台:通过数据中台,企业可以实现数据的统一管理、分析和应用,支持业务的快速创新。
  2. 数字孪生:通过数字孪生技术,企业可以构建虚拟模型,实现对物理世界的实时模拟和优化。
  3. 数字可视化:通过数字可视化平台,企业可以将复杂的数据转化为直观的图表和仪表盘,支持决策者快速了解业务状态。

结语

国产自研数据底座通过分布式计算和高可用性架构,为企业提供了高效、可靠、安全的数据管理与分析能力。无论是数据中台、数字孪生还是数字可视化,数据底座都扮演着至关重要的角色。对于企业而言,选择一款合适的国产自研数据底座,不仅能够提升数据处理效率,还能够降低数据管理的成本,为企业创造更大的价值。

如果您对国产自研数据底座感兴趣,不妨申请试用,体验其强大的功能与性能。申请试用&https://www.dtstack.com/?src=bbs

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料